Решение для подключения приёма платежей через NextPay.ru.
Возможна работа с юридическими лицами, с заключением договора или без договора. При работе без заключения договора в соответствии с 54-ФЗ для магазина отсутствует необходимость установки кассы. Подробнее о данном решении в статье "Решение для соответствия 54-ФЗ".
Настройки в системе nextpay.ru
Вам необходимо зайти в кабинет продавца на сайте nextpay.ru и создать продукт: Кабинет продавца - Каталоги - Создать продукт:
* В поле "Форма заказа" указать: "Оплата счёта (без договора)" или "Оплата счета"
Установите решение "NextPay. Приём платежей в соответствии с 54-ФЗ без кассы." из Marketplace.
Создайте платежную систему bitrix:
На странице Магазин/Платёжные системы (/bitrix/admin/sale_pay_system.php), Вам необходимо будет добавить добавить платежную систему. В качестве обработчика необходимо выбрать обработчик "Оплата в платежной системе NextPay.ru (nextpay_payment)" из группы "Пользовательские". В настройках обработчика вам необходимо указать:
* Секретный ключ продавца в системе nextpay.ru
В первом списке выбрать "Значение", во втором поле указать секретный ключ продавца в системе nextpay.ru
Значение секретного ключ продавца в системе nextpay.ru смотрите в кабинете продавца на сайте nextpay.ru: Кабинет продавца - Настройки
* ID продукта в системе nextpay.ru
В первом списке выбрать "Значение", во втором поле указать ID продукта в системе nextpay.ru
Значение ID продукта в системе nextpay.ru смотрите в кабинете продавца на сайте nextpay.ru: Кабинет продавца - Каталоги - Продукты. Это именно тот продукт, создание которого описано разделе "Настройки в системе nextpay.ru"
* Номер заказа в системе bitrix
Установите следующее: в первом списке выбрать "Заказ", во втором списке выбрать "Код заказа (ID)"
Проверка тестовых платежей
Чтобы проверить работоспособность платёжной системы Вам необходимо
* Создать заказ в системе bitrix * Зайти в кабинет продавца на сайте nextpay.ru и сделать тестовый платеж: Кабинет продавца - Каталоги – Продукты - Тестовый заказ. В поле "Номер счета" указать номер заказа в системе bitrix, созданного ранее (на предыдущем шаге)
1.0.1, 03.10.2018
Данное обновление устраняет проблему, которая может приводить к неработоспособности решения на некоторых системах битркис